Key Differences

CategoryCommercial Real EstateREI Loans
Property PurposeWhere your business operatesInvestment/flip property
Interest Rate5-12% APR8-15% APR
Maximum Amount$100K-$5M$50K-$2M
Loan Duration10-25 years3-5 years (flips) or longer
Income SourceYour business operationsProperty appreciation or rental

Commercial Real Estate is Best For

  • Franchisees buying property to run their franchise location
  • Salon owners purchasing the building they operate from
  • Restaurant owners buying the building that houses their restaurant

REI Loans is Best For

  • Real estate investors flipping single-family homes or multi-units
  • Portfolio builders purchasing rental properties for passive income
  • House flippers acquiring distressed properties for renovation and resale

The Verdict for New Haven

Choose CRE financing if you're buying property to operate your business from (replacing lease payments). Choose REI loans if you're buying property as an investment to flip or rent for returns—they serve different purposes and borrower types.
